Integration tests: end-to-end PTY + terminal-emulation round-trip. //! //! These tests spawn real subprocesses via portable-pty and verify that //! the alacritty_terminal emulator receives and renders the output. They //! run on any Linux (and macOS) without any system graphics deps. use std::collections::HashMap; use std::time::{Duration, Instant}; use mrxvt::alacritty_terminal::grid::Dimensions; use mrxvt::config::{Config, Profile}; use mrxvt::terminal::tab::TerminalTab; fn sh_profile(cmd: &str) -> Profile { Profile { command: vec!["sh".into(), "-c".into(), cmd.into()], cwd: None, tag: None, env: HashMap::new(), } } /// Poll a tab until its visible grid contains `needle`, or panic. fn wait_for(tab: &mut TerminalTab, needle: &str, timeout: Duration) { let deadline = Instant::now() + timeout; while Instant::now() < deadline { let _ = tab.poll_pty(); if grid_contains(tab, needle) { return; } std::thread::sleep(Duration::from_millis(20)); } panic!("timeout waiting for {needle:?} in terminal grid"); } /// Walk the visible grid and check for a substring match across each row. fn grid_contains(tab: &TerminalTab, needle: &str) -> bool { let grid = tab.term.grid(); let cols = grid.columns(); let lines = grid.screen_lines(); let display_offset = grid.display_offset(); let start = -(display_offset as i32); for row in 0..lines as i32 { let mut s = String::with_capacity(cols); for col in 0..cols { let point = mrxvt::re_export_point(start + row, col); let cell = &grid[point]; s.push(cell.c); } if s.contains(needle) { return true; } } false } #[test] fn echo_appears_in_grid() { let p = sh_profile("echo integration_test_marker_42"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 60, 10, 1_000).unwrap(); wait_for(&mut tab, "integration_test_marker_42", Duration::from_secs(3)); } #[test] fn colored_output_is_parsed() { // Print "RED" in red, then "PLAIN" in default. let p = sh_profile("printf '\\033[31mRED\\033[0m PLAIN'"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 40, 5, 1_000).unwrap(); wait_for(&mut tab, "RED", Duration::from_secs(3)); wait_for(&mut tab, "PLAIN", Duration::from_secs(3)); } #[test] fn input_round_trip() { // Start an interactive `cat` — echo back what we type. let p = sh_profile("cat"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 40, 5, 1_000).unwrap(); // Give cat a moment to start. std::thread::sleep(Duration::from_millis(100)); // Send some input. tab.write_input(b"hello_round_trip\n").unwrap(); wait_for(&mut tab, "hello_round_trip", Duration::from_secs(3)); } #[test] fn resize_preserves_content() { let p = sh_profile("echo preserve_me; sleep 5"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 60, 10, 1_000).unwrap(); wait_for(&mut tab, "preserve_me", Duration::from_secs(3)); // Resize to smaller, then larger. Content should still be visible. tab.resize(40, 5).unwrap(); tab.resize(80, 24).unwrap(); // After resize, the marker may be in scrollback. Switch to grid view // and just assert the terminal didn't crash. let (c, r) = tab.size(); assert!(c > 0 && r > 0); } #[test] fn eof_detected_after_child_exits() { let p = sh_profile("true"); // exits immediately let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 40, 5, 1_000).unwrap(); // Poll until EOF is observed (the reader thread sends an empty-vec sentinel). let deadline = Instant::now() + Duration::from_secs(5); while Instant::now() < deadline { let _ = tab.poll_pty(); if tab.is_dead() { return; } std::thread::sleep(Duration::from_millis(20)); } panic!("tab never observed EOF"); } #[test] fn ansi_cursor_movement() { // Print "ABC", move cursor back two, overwrite with "XY" → "AXY" let p = sh_profile("printf 'ABC\\b\\bXY'"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 40, 5, 1_000).unwrap(); wait_for(&mut tab, "AXY", Duration::from_secs(3)); } #[test] fn large_output_doesnt_crash() { // Print 1000 lines. let p = sh_profile("for i in $(seq 1 1000); do echo line_$i; done; sleep 1"); let mut tab = TerminalTab::new("t".into(), &p, "/bin/sh", 80, 24, 5_000).unwrap(); // We just need the last line to appear eventually. wait_for(&mut tab, "line_1000", Duration::from_secs(10)); } #[test] fn tabs_can_be_created_independently() { let p1 = sh_profile("echo tab_one_marker; sleep 5"); let p2 = sh_profile("echo tab_two_marker; sleep 5"); let mut t1 = TerminalTab::new("t1".into(), &p1, "/bin/sh", 60, 10, 1_000).unwrap(); let mut t2 = TerminalTab::new("t2".into(), &p2, "/bin/sh", 60, 10, 1_000).unwrap(); wait_for(&mut t1, "tab_one_marker", Duration::from_secs(3)); wait_for(&mut t2, "tab_two_marker", Duration::from_secs(3)); // Each tab got its own marker. assert!(grid_contains(&t1, "tab_one_marker")); assert!(!grid_contains(&t1, "tab_two_marker")); assert!(grid_contains(&t2, "tab_two_marker")); assert!(!grid_contains(&t2, "tab_one_marker")); } #[test] fn config_loads_from_temp_file() { let toml = r#" [terminal] cols = 100 rows = 30 [profiles.default] command = ["bash"] "#; let tmp = tempfile::NamedTempFile::new().unwrap(); std::fs::write(tmp.path(), toml).unwrap(); let cfg = Config::load(Some(tmp.path())).unwrap(); assert_eq!(cfg.terminal.cols, 100); assert_eq!(cfg.terminal.rows, 30); assert_eq!(cfg.profiles["default"].command, vec!["bash".to_string()]); } #[test] fn default_config_is_sane() { let cfg = Config::default(); assert!(cfg.terminal.cols >= 80); assert!(!cfg.terminal.shell.is_empty()); assert_eq!(cfg.default_profile, "default"); }
